What is TinyG?

The TinyG project is a many-axis motion control system. It is designed for small CNC applications and other applications that require highly controllable motion control. TinyG is meant to be a complete embedded solution for small/medium motor control. Here are some of the main features:

*Full, integrated motion control system with embedded microcontroller (Atmel ATxmega192) and 4 stepper motor drivers (TI DRV8811) integrated on a ~4 inch square board *Accepts Gcode from USB port and interprets it locally on the board *6-axis control (XYZ + ABC rotary axes) *Acceleration planning performed using constant jerk motion equations (3rd order S curves) for very smooth and fast motion transitions for lines and arcs *Very smooth step pulse generation using phase-optimized, smart oversampling, fractional step DDA running at 50 Khz with very low jitter (<<1uSec) *Networkable via RS485 to support motion peripherals and for networking mutliple boards for multi-axis systems and for really interesting projects (up to 1000 stepper axes) *Stepper drivers handle 2.5 amps per winding which will handle most motors up thru NEMA23 and some NEMA34 motors. *Microstepping up to 1/8 (optimized DDA makes this smoother than many 1/16 implementations)
